The Vendor is required to provide for is a standalone system used by members and administrators to manage Extra Duty and overtime staffing.
- The platform enables clients to:
• Request police staffing and supports assignment of sworn and non-sworn personnel based on availability, skills, experience, and training.
• Support operational setup, including file uploads, and creation of deployment templates.
• Capture after-action reports and job feedback, generate client billing, and archive completed jobs.
• Provide administrative dashboards and reporting, including upcoming job overviews and daily member scheduling visibility.
- Client Requests:
• The system must allow administrative users to create and maintain client profiles, capture client applications received via the EDD inbox, link applications to existing client records, and approve or deny applications as required.
• The system must allow administrative users to send a Client Feedback Form upon job completion. The feedback form must automatically close 72 hours after it is sent.
• The system must allow completed client feedback forms to be saved and retained within the application.
- Employees
• The system must allow members (EPS sworn employees) to sign in via single sign on and sign up online for extra duty.
• The system must prevent recruits from signing up for Extra Duty assignments by validating member job codes through integration with Employee Central, allowing eligibility only once the job code changes to Constable.
• The system must allow administrative users to create and maintain member profiles, manage skills and eligibility documentation, approve EDD participation, and assign training modules.
• The system must populate basic employee information and employment changes through integration with SuccessFactors Employee Central.
• The system must allow members to complete assigned training modules and restrict extra duty assignments until all required training is completed.
• The system must allow administrative users to view and update training records for members as required.
• The system must allow members to create and maintain employment profiles, including skills required for extra duty selection, preferred notification methods, and preferences for job type and location/division.
• The system must allow administrators to track member performance, including supervisory job shadowing, and manage disciplinary records and loss of privileges.
• The system must allow members to enter their availability dates and times and validate entries against Extra Duty Scheduling Restrictions. The system must, through integration with WFS, prevent members from volunteering and gray out availability when they are scheduled for Standby/On Call, have an EDD loss of privileges, or are on long‑term leave, including WCB gradual return to work.
• The system must allow members to view their job history and upcoming scheduled assignments.
• The system must allow members to transfer scheduled extra duty assignments to another eligible member in accordance with Extra Duty Scheduling Restrictions.
- Extra Duty Scheduling
• The system must allow administrative users to create and maintain job descriptions using standardized templates for various extra duty assignments.
• The system must allow administrative users to initiate member availability screening after event staffing levels are defined and approved, including the ability to filter by time slot and send mass SMS or email notifications to available members for urgent or last‑minute staffing requests.
• The system must allow administrative users to view member profiles (including EDD work history, skills, and job and location preferences) and member availability in accordance with Extra Duty Scheduling Restrictions.
• The system must allow administrative users to select and assign members to specific events from an availability list that displays key member details, links to full profiles, scheduled conflicts, and assignment actions (e.g., select, assign vehicle, decline or unavailable by phone).
• The system must also display assignment status and performance statistics, including accepted, pending, declined, unavailable, penalties, given away, and lost assignments.
• The system must allow administrative users to create and maintain diarist profiles and assign diarists to extra duty jobs as required.
• The system must display a warning when a member is scheduled for multiple events on the same day.
